Fuse is looking for a Technically savvy, driven hands-on Project Manager with a "get it done" mindset to lead the development, integration, and demonstration of advanced communications and networking technologies. In this role, you will oversee and manage all aspects of project execution and provide strategic guidance to the team and stakeholders. Our work focuses on DoD network and tactical communications providing a variety of communications abilities to USN, USAF, and USMC platforms including tactical data links, line of site and beyond line-of-sight radios, and crossbanding of IP data. This engineering-minded Project Manager must be passionate about enhancing operator capabilities with user-focused communication, network, and software systems.

Warfighter-focused design and development is at the heart of Fuse processes. Throughout Fuse development, our experienced team applies the best practices of commercial design-thinking, coupled to the DoD systems engineering framework. The combination of commercially proven design with rigorous systems engineering gives Fuse the ability to rapidly design, develop and field solutions well inside of typical military design cycles. Fuse rapidly innovates, putting creative concepts into action and refining those concepts through hands-on testing, user evaluation, and iterations.
